分析操作系统内核:内核如何影响系统性能和稳定性

时间:2025-04-21 13:18:24 分类:操作系统

分析操作系统内核:内核如何影响系统性能和稳定性

分析操作系统内核:内核如何影响系统性能和稳定性

操作系统内核作为系统的核心部件,扮演着连接硬件与软件应用的关键角色。内核管理系统资源,调度进程,并保证系统的稳定性和安全性。对于系统性能的影响,内核的设计和实现方式至关重要,因此疫后的市场趋势以及与之相关的新技术进展,特别值得关注。

当今市场上,越来越多的操作系统在内核设计上追求高效和稳定。例如,Linux内核通过不断更新的版本,推出了一系列的性能优化策略,减小了内存使用,减少了上下文切换的开销,提升了多线程处理的效率。这些优化不仅提升了服务器性能,也对桌面用户产生了积极影响。

DIY组装爱好者在挑选操作系统时,常常考虑内核对系统性能的影响。例如,选择低延迟的实时内核可以为游戏和音视频处理提供更好的体验。在组装过程中,使用SSD替代传统HDD,搭配更高效的内核,能够极大缩短启动时间和程序加载时间,提升用户体验。正确配置内核参数和文件系统也会对系统稳定性产生显著影响,从而确保在高负载条件下的可靠性。

在性能优化的领域,内核始终是焦点。通过跟踪内核性能指标(如CPU利用率、内存带宽和I/O性能),用户能够发现瓶颈,并针对性地调整调度策略和内存管理方式。现代操作系统开始支持内存压缩和内存页共享等新技术,这些技术可以有效减少内存占用,从而提升整体系统性能。

未来市场趋势将更加强调安全性与隐私保护,尤其是在云计算和物联网环境下。内核的安全性设计将直接影响到整个系统的防御能力。例如,微内核架构的兴起,意在通过最小化内核代码量,降低攻击面,从而提升系统安全性。这种转变虽然可能会带来一定的性能损失,但通过优化与现代硬件的结合,用户正在看到越来越好的解决方案。

操作系统内核的选择与设计不仅关系到系统的基本性能和稳定性,还是用户在进行DIY组装与优化过程中必须考虑的重要因素。对这些技术的深入了解,将为提升信息技术应用环境的整体质量提供有力支持。

常见问题解答(FAQ):

1. 为什么内核设计对系统性能如此重要?

内核是硬件与应用程序之间的桥梁,影响资源管理、调度效率和系统响应速度。

2. 哪种类型的内核适合游戏和多媒体处理?

实时内核因其低延迟特性,在游戏和多媒体处理方面表现突出。

3. 如何优化Linux内核的性能?

通过调整内核参数、更新内核版本、使用高效的文件系统以及配置合适的调度策略可以提高性能。

4. 微内核架构的优势是什么?

微内核架构减少了内核代码量,降低攻击面,从而提升系统安全性,同时保持高效性。

5. 怎样选择合适的操作系统进行DIY组装?

根据用途选择适合的内核,以及考虑硬件兼容性和维护性,选择已被优化的版本会有助于提升整体性能。